Strong’s Definitions

αΌ€Ξ½α½±Ξ²Ξ»Ξ΅ΟˆΞΉΟ‚ anáblepsis, an-ab'-lep-sis; from G308; restoration of sight:—recovery of sight.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 1x

The KJV translates Strong's G309 in the following manner: recovering of sight (1x).

STRONGS G309:
αΌ€Ξ½α½±Ξ²Ξ»Ξ΅ΟˆΞΉΟ‚, -Ρως, αΌ‘, recovery of sight: Luke 4:18 (19) (Sept. Isaiah 61:1). [Aristotle.]
